Inclusion for Active Citizenship

The training activity took place
in Durres, Albania
organised by Roma Active Albania
November 2007

Aims & objectives

Aims and objectives:

- giving participants tools to work with youth minorities in order to integrate them in the communities where they live;
- promoting the inclusion of young people from minority communities in the society exchanging competences on minority issues;
- empowering minority young people and minority communities in acquiring knowledge and skills on minorities;
- improving the quality of minority-focused projects, organised by the partner organisations in the future, both within and outside the Youth in Action programme;
- using non formal education as a tool for social change (presenting Compass manual)
- empowering the activities of the Youth Organizations which come from countries where minority communities are present and which work with minorities;
- building a new network composed by trainers and youth workers working with minorities with the aim to involve them in youth activities supported by the Youth Programme and by other programmes of aid;
- promoting the Youth in Action Programme as a tool for minority youth work
- setting up new partnerships


Target group & international/intercultural composition of the group & team

Team: two trainers (Luca Frongia and Max Fras), facilitators from PEL Macedonia and Beyond Barriers Albania, project manager (Roma Active Albania)

Target group: youth workers, youth leaders, volunteers, project managers involved in youth work

Participant countries: Albania, Kosovo, Macedonia, Italy, Germany, United Kingdom

Training methods used & main activities

Training Methods: presentation of Compass and workshops using the manual, as well as other resources for citizenship work; group work on concepts of citizenship; reflection groups, amongst others

Outcomes of the activity

- Local follow-up projects in Albania
- Increased competences in non-formal education among TC participants
- Youth in Action - Action 1.1 and 3.1 projects

Your tasks and responsibilities within the team

Tasks and responsibilities as co-trainer: preparation and delivery of non-formal educational activities, project evaluation
